## Data Stores — PortionPal

Heads up, future maintainers: PortionPal (our recipe-scaling calculator) keeps things simple. Scaled recipe snapshots live in the `portions` Postgres database, while ingredient conversion tables sit in a read-mostly `units` schema. Don't be tempted to cache conversions in app memory — we tried, it got weird with seasonal unit overrides. Migrations run via the usual `pp-migrate` wrapper on deploy. For local poking around, connect with the string below.

primary connection of yagep-kahip = redis://giliel_svc:zYiKsLL2PLpfPL@db-348f.xolmarsys.corp:5432/fenwyn

## Deploying the Gatewick Proctor Queue

Deploys are pretty painless: push to main, wait for the pipeline, then watch the queue drain dashboard for five minutes. If candidates pile up mid-exam, roll back first and ask questions later — the queue replays safely. Everything the workers care about lives in one config block, shown here for reference.

settings of bafof-yagef:
JOROX_PIN=8740
JOROX_TENANT=pelox
JOROX_METRICS_HOST=metrics.jorox.qorvelworks.internal
JOROX_SEAL=seal_c78f63c1
JOROX_STANDBY_TEAM=norax

## Env Vars — Wayhop Deep-Link Router

Wayhop routes mobile deep links to app screens or web fallbacks. Route maps ship in the build; only runtime values live in the env file. Required at boot: region, fallback host, and the link-signing secret. Missing values fail the health check, so verify before promoting a release. Region and fallback host are already set above. The link-signing secret goes on the next line.

secret setting of tagep-kahof: LEDGER_TOKEN20=80bd9b2ecab69905fd32

## N+1 fix — notes for eng sync

The Quillbase GraphQL layer was firing one resolver call per order line, hammering the Tallyhook inventory service. Fix: batched loaders keyed by SKU, single round trip per request. p95 latency dropped 62% on staging. Rollout gated behind the `batch_loaders` flag; flip it per-tenant. Monitoring lives in the Drumlin dashboard under "resolver fanout." To replay production traffic against staging you must authenticate to the Tallyhook replay endpoint with the key below.

service key, fawip-bajef: kto11_Qt5wZK9vdNC